1806 in science
The year 1806 in science and technology included many events, some of which are listed here.

Awards
- Copley Medal: Thomas Andrew Knight
Births
- April 9 - Isambard Kingdom Brunel, British engineer († 1859)
- December 11 - Otto Wilhelm Hermann von Abich, German geologist († 1886)
Deaths
- June 23 - Mathurin Jacques Brisson, French zoologist (born 1723)
- August 23 - Charles-Augustin de Coulomb, physicist (born 1736)
